Haitian International Holdings 5-Year Yield-on-Cost % Calculation

Dividend Yield % and dividend growth of a stock is an important factor for income investors. But if company A raises its dividend constantly faster than company B, company A's future dividend yield might be much higher than Company B's even if their yields are the same now and their stock prices do not change.

Yield on Cost assumes that you buy and the stock today, and hold it for 5 years. If the company raises it dividends at the same rate as it did over the past 5 years, the dividends investors receive annually in 5 years relative to the stock price today.

Therefore, Yield-on-Cost of Haitian International Holdings is calculated as

Yield-on-Cost=Dividend Yield %*(1+Dividend Growth Rate)^5

Haitian International Holdings Business Description

Other Exchanges 01882:Hong KongHI6:Germany
Address No.1688 Haitian Road, Beilun District, Zhejiang Province, Ningbo, CHN, 315800
Haitian International Holdings Ltd is an investment holding company that manufactures and distributes plastic injection molding machines and related products. It offers hydraulic and electric plastic injection molding machines. The group operates in Mainland China, Hong Kong, and other countries. The company generates the majority of its revenue from Mainland China through the sale of plastic injection molding machines and related products.
